Gunther has no sympathy for the millions of fans mourning the end of John Cena’s career. The Ring General sat down with TMZ Inside The Ring to discuss his historic victory at Saturday Night’s Main Event. During the interview, he offered a harsh reality check to those upset that the sixteen-time World Champion did not get a storybook ending.

The former World Heavyweight Champion made headlines around the globe when he forced Cena to tap out to a sleeper hold in Washington, D.C. The finish was a shocking subversion of the “Never Give Up” mantra that defined Cena’s two-decade run. When asked what he had to say to the angry fan base, Gunther told them to stop crying because life goes on. He noted that anyone naive enough to believe the slogan would hold up forever only has themselves to blame.

Despite the controversy, the Austrian powerhouse admitted that this was arguably the most meaningful win of his career. He compared the atmosphere to the night Brock Lesnar ended The Undertaker’s undefeated streak at WrestleMania. Gunther acknowledged the immense pressure that comes with such a milestone, stating that it is now his responsibility to protect the gift he was given.

The champion also revealed that he isolated himself backstage immediately following the match. While family and long-time peers surrounded Cena, Gunther chose not to bathe in the emotion of the moment. He instead left the venue to let the damage he caused settle in. He teased that he would address his future on Monday Night Raw, promising to enjoy the fallout of his actions.
